Trong bối cảnh làm việc linh hoạt hiện nay, việc quản lý và triển khai phần mềm trên hàng loạt thiết bị khác nhau đã trở thành một thách thức lớn đối với bộ phận IT. Application virtualization (Ảo hóa ứng dụng) nổi lên như một giải pháp đột phá, cho phép phần mềm chạy trên các thiết bị của người dùng mà không cần cài đặt trực tiếp vào hệ điều hành cục bộ. Công nghệ này giúp tối ưu hóa tài nguyên mà còn đảm bảo tính bảo mật và sự đồng nhất trong môi trường số của tổ chức. Hãy cùng ATPro Corp tìm hiểu Application virtualization là gì? Các giải pháp và ứng dụng trong doanh nghiệp qua bài viết sau đây.
Tìm hiểu khái niệm Application virtualization là gì?
Application Virtualization (ảo hóa ứng dụng) là công nghệ cho phép chạy ứng dụng mà không cần cài đặt trực tiếp trên thiết bị người dùng. Thay vào đó, ứng dụng được đóng gói và tách biệt khỏi hệ điều hành, hoạt động trong một môi trường ảo hóa độc lập.
Người dùng có thể truy cập ứng dụng thông qua mạng nội bộ (LAN) hoặc Internet, trong khi toàn bộ quá trình xử lý chính có thể diễn ra trên máy chủ hoặc một lớp trung gian.

Đặc điểm chính:
- Không cần thiết phải cài đặt trực tiếp trên từng máy tính
- Các ứng dụng hoạt động độc lập với hệ điều hành
- Triển khai và cập nhật tập trung từ máy chủ
- Giảm phụ thuộc vào cấu hình phần cứng thiết bị đầu cuối
- Hạn chế xung đột phần mềm
Phân biệt Application virtualization với các công nghệ ảo hóa khác
Ảo hóa máy chủ (tiếng anh Server Virtualization)
- Tạo nhiều máy chủ ảo ở trên một máy chủ vật lý
- Mỗi máy ảo đều có hệ điều hành riêng
- Tập trung vào tối ưu tài nguyên phần cứng
Ảo hóa máy tính để bàn (tiếng anh Desktop Virtualization)
- Cung cấp toàn bộ môi trường desktop (OS + ứng dụng) từ xa
- Người dùng truy cập như một máy tính hoàn chỉnh
- Phù hợp cho làm việc từ xa, trung tâm dữ liệu
Ảo hóa ứng dụng (tiếng anh Application Virtualization)
- Chỉ ảo hóa ứng dụng, không ảo hóa toàn bộ hệ điều hành
- Nhẹ hơn, triển khai nhanh hơn
- Tập trung chủ lực vào trải nghiệm sử dụng phần mềm
Điểm khác biệt cốt lõi:
Application Virtualization chỉ xử lý ở tầng ứng dụng, trong khi các công nghệ còn lại ảo hóa ở mức hệ thống (server hoặc desktop).
Các mô hình triển khai tiêu biểu của ảo hóa ứng dụng
Cung cấp ứng dụng từ xa (Remote Application Delivery)
Cách thức vận hành
Trong mô hình này, ứng dụng được cài đặt và vận hành hoàn toàn trên máy chủ trung tâm (data center hoặc cloud). Khi người dùng truy cập:
- Mọi xử lý nghiệp vụ, tính toán và lưu trữ dữ liệu diễn ra trên server
- Thiết bị đầu cuối chỉ đóng vai trò hiển thị giao diện và gửi lệnh điều khiển
- Luồng dữ liệu truyền đi chủ yếu là hình ảnh màn hình và thao tác người dùng
Các kết nối thường sử dụng giao thức tối ưu hiển thị từ xa như Remote Desktop Protocol hoặc Independent Computing Architecture. Đảm bảo trải nghiệm mượt mà ngay cả trên mạng có băng thông hạn chế.
Lợi ích chính
- Tối ưu thiết bị đầu cuối: Máy trạm cấu hình thấp vẫn chạy được ứng dụng nặng
- Tăng cường bảo mật: Dữ liệu không lưu trên thiết bị cá nhân, giảm rủi ro rò rỉ
- Quản trị tập trung: Cập nhật phần mềm, vá lỗi và phân quyền thực hiện tại server
- Đảm bảo tính đồng nhất: Toàn bộ người dùng sử dụng cùng một phiên bản ứng dụng
Ứng dụng:
- Ngành tài chính – ngân hàng: Kiểm soát truy cập hệ thống lõi, bảo vệ dữ liệu giao dịch
- Tổ chức đào tạo trực tuyến: Cung cấp phần mềm học tập mà không cần cài đặt tại máy cá nhân
- Doanh nghiệp nhiều chi nhánh: Nhân sự truy cập hệ thống nội bộ từ xa một cách an toàn
Một số nền tảng triển khai phổ biến gồm Microsoft Remote Desktop Services và giải pháp từ Citrix Systems.
Ứng dụng phát trực tuyến (Streaming Applications)
Cách thức vận hành
Khác với mô hình tập trung hoàn toàn, phương pháp này cho phép ứng dụng được tải xuống từng phần đến thiết bị người dùng:
- Khi khởi chạy, chỉ các thành phần cần thiết mới được tải về trước
- Các module còn lại sẽ tiếp tục được truyền về khi người dùng sử dụng đến
- Một phần xử lý diễn ra trên client, phần còn lại vẫn phụ thuộc server
Cách tiếp cận này tạo ra sự cân bằng giữa hiệu suất và khả năng tối ưu tài nguyên mạng.
Lợi ích chính
- Giảm tải băng thông: Không cần tải toàn bộ ứng dụng ngay từ đầu
- Thời gian khởi động nhanh: Người dùng có thể sử dụng gần như ngay lập tức
- Khả năng thích ứng cao: Hoạt động trên nhiều nền tảng và môi trường khác nhau
- Giảm chi phí lưu trữ: Không cần cài đặt đầy đủ ứng dụng trên từng thiết bị
Ứng dụng
- Thiết kế kỹ thuật (CAD/CAM): Sử dụng các phần mềm nặng như AutoCAD hoặc SolidWorks mà không cần cài đặt đầy đủ
- Hệ thống bán lẻ (POS): Triển khai nhanh phần mềm bán hàng tại nhiều điểm
- Quản lý kho: Đồng bộ ứng dụng kiểm kê, vận hành linh hoạt trên nhiều thiết bị
Application Virtualization mang đến những lợi ích gì cho doanh nghiệp?
Tối ưu chi phí vận hành: doanh nghiệp hạn chế phụ thuộc vào phần cứng cấu hình cao và giảm chi phí bảo trì hệ thống. Việc triển khai ứng dụng tập trung cũng giúp cắt giảm chi phí cài đặt, nâng cấp và quản lý phần mềm trên từng thiết bị.
Tăng tính linh hoạt trong làm việc: Người dùng có thể truy cập ứng dụng từ bất kỳ đâu thông qua Internet, không bị giới hạn bởi vị trí địa lý hay thiết bị. Điều này đặc biệt phù hợp với mô hình làm việc hybrid và doanh nghiệp nhiều chi nhánh.
Nâng cao bảo mật dữ liệu: Dữ liệu không lưu trên máy cá nhân mà được quản lý tại server, doanh nghiệp kiểm soát truy cập chặt chẽ hơn. Ngoài ra, các chính sách bảo mật như phân quyền, mã hóa và sao lưu cũng được triển khai đồng bộ.
Đơn giản hóa quản trị hệ thống IT: Đội ngũ IT chỉ cần thực hiện cập nhật và bảo trì tại máy chủ thay vì từng thiết bị riêng lẻ. Giảm khối lượng công việc, hạn chế lỗi hệ thống và tăng hiệu quả quản lý.
Cải thiện hiệu suất làm việc: Ứng dụng hoạt động trong môi trường ảo hóa được kiểm soát giúp giảm xung đột phần mềm và lỗi hệ điều hành. Tận dụng tài nguyên máy chủ mạnh giúp tăng tốc độ xử lý và nâng cao trải nghiệm người dùng.
Dễ dàng mở rộng và tích hợp hệ thống: Thêm người dùng hoặc triển khai ứng dụng mới mà không cần thay đổi lớn về hạ tầng. Ngoài ra, hệ thống dễ dàng tích hợp với các nền tảng như SAP ERP hoặc Salesforce để đồng bộ dữ liệu và tối ưu vận hành.
Các ứng dụng của Application Virtualization trong doanh nghiệp
Lĩnh vực tài chính – ngân hàng
Tăng cường bảo mật và kiểm soát hệ thống nghiệp vụ, Application Virtualization cho phép các tổ chức tài chính triển khai ứng dụng trên hạ tầng tập trung. Giúp dữ liệu khách hàng luôn được lưu trữ tại máy chủ thay vì trên thiết bị cá nhân. Điều này giảm thiểu rủi ro rò rỉ thông tin và hỗ trợ kiểm soát truy cập chặt chẽ.
Ngoài ra, nhân sự làm việc từ xa thông qua môi trường truy cập an toàn mà vẫn đảm bảo tuân thủ các tiêu chuẩn bảo mật. Việc triển khai hoặc cập nhật ứng dụng cũng diễn ra nhanh chóng, không làm gián đoạn hoạt động kinh doanh.
Lĩnh vực giáo dục
Các tổ chức giáo dục cung cấp phần mềm học tập cho số lượng lớn người dùng mà không cần cài đặt trên từng thiết bị. Sinh viên và giảng viên chỉ cần kết nối Internet để truy cập hệ thống học tập từ xa.
Mô hình này đặc biệt hiệu quả trong đào tạo trực tuyến, giúp đồng bộ tài nguyên giảng dạy, kiểm soát phiên bản phần mềm và tối ưu chi phí quản lý phòng máy. Đồng thời, nhà trường dễ dàng quản lý quyền truy cập và theo dõi hoạt động học tập.
Lĩnh vực sản xuất và bán lẻ
Doanh nghiệp sản xuất và bán lẻ triển khai các hệ thống quản lý như SAP ERP hoặc Salesforce dưới dạng ảo hóa ứng dụng. Giúp truy cập tập trung và đồng bộ dữ liệu giữa các bộ phận như kho, bán hàng, kế toán.
Nhờ đó, thông tin được cập nhật theo thời gian thực, hỗ trợ ra quyết định nhanh và chính xác. Ngoài ra, khi mở rộng chi nhánh hoặc điểm bán, doanh nghiệp triển khai hệ thống nhanh chóng mà không cần đầu tư hạ tầng CNTT phức tạp tại từng địa điểm.
Xem thêm: Mô hình mạng LAN là gì? 3 Mô hình đem lại hiệu suất bảo mật cao
Hy vọng với bài viết “Application Virtualization là gì? Các giải pháp và ứng dụng trong doanh nghiệp” của ATPro Corp, bạn đã có cái nhìn rõ ràng hơn về công nghệ ảo hóa ứng dụng cũng như cách triển khai hiệu quả trong thực tế.
Tham khảo ngay các sản phẩm đang được bán chạy nhất tại ATPro
ATPro - Cung cấp phần mềm SCADA, MES, quản lý điện năng, hệ thống gọi số, hệ thống xếp hàng, đồng hồ LED treo tường, đồng hồ đo lưu lượng, máy tính công nghiệp, màn hình HMI, IoT Gateway, đèn tín hiệu, đèn giao thông, đèn máy CNC, bộ đếm sản phẩm, bảng LED năng suất, cảm biến công nghiệp,...uy tín chất lượng giá tốt. Được khách hàng tin dùng tại Việt Nam.














Bài viết liên quan
Mô hình mạng LAN là gì? 3 Mô hình đem lại hiệu suất bảo mật cao
Trong lĩnh vực hạ tầng mạng, mô hình mạng LAN là việc kết nối các [...]
Th5
Hướng dẫn cách đo và kiểm tra tụ điện bằng đồng hồ vạn năng chính xác
Trong các mạch điện tử, tụ điện là linh kiện quan trọng giúp lưu trữ [...]
Th5
AI face recognition là gì? 6 Ứng dụng nổi bật trong thực tiễn
Trong bối cảnh công nghệ trí tuệ nhân tạo phát triển mạnh mẽ, nhận diện [...]
Th5
Các loại chữ ký điện tử thông dụng nhất trên thị trường hiện nay
Trong bối cảnh chuyển đổi số, chữ ký điện tử trở thành công cụ không [...]
Th5
Nền tảng số là gì? 38 Nền tảng số quốc gia phục vụ chuyển đổi số Việt Nam.
Chuyển đổi số đang diễn ra mạnh mẽ, các doanh nghiệp hiện nay buộc phải [...]
Th5
Quy trình lưu trữ hồ sơ chuẩn ISO CHUẨN kèm 3 phương pháp hiệu quả
Việc quản trị dữ liệu một cách khoa học đã trở thành ‘xương sống’ cho [...]
Th5